President Donald Trump has issued a directive to the US Navy, affecting its aircraft carriers. The order involves removing a newer system used to launch fighter jets and replacing it with an older method. The newer system, known as the Electromagnetic Aircraft Launch System, will be removed from the Navy's newest carriers.

This change is expected to be costly and may impact the operation and maintenance of the ships.
